[發明專利]視差圖的獲取方法、裝置、計算機設備和存儲介質有效
| 申請號: | 201910911950.2 | 申請日: | 2019-09-25 |
| 公開(公告)號: | CN110866535B | 公開(公告)日: | 2022-07-29 |
| 發明(設計)人: | 王鵬 | 申請(專利權)人: | 北京邁格威科技有限公司 |
| 主分類號: | G06V10/74 | 分類號: | G06V10/74;G06K9/62 |
| 代理公司: | 北京華進京聯知識產權代理有限公司 11606 | 代理人: | 朱五云 |
| 地址: | 100190 北京市海淀區科*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 視差 獲取 方法 裝置 計算機 設備 存儲 介質 | ||
本發明涉及一種視差圖的獲取方法、裝置、計算機設備和存儲介質。該方法通過采用融合多種類型的匹配代價函數計算輸入圖像中各像素點的匹配代價值,得到第一匹配代價,再對第一匹配代價進行匹配代價聚合,得到第二匹配代價,接著采用SGM算法或GSM算法,對輸入圖像中的邊緣像素點在第二匹配代價中對應的匹配代價值進行優化,得到第三匹配代價,然后根據第三匹配代價確定出所有像素點的目標匹配代價值,并根據目標匹配代價值對應的視差值得到輸入圖像的視差圖。上述視差圖的獲取方法,可以提高輸入圖像中非邊緣像素點區域的視差一致性,以及輸入圖像中邊緣像素點的匹配代價計算的準確性。
技術領域
本申請涉及計算機視覺技術領域,尤其涉及一種視差圖的獲取方法、裝置、計算機設備和存儲介質。
背景技術
隨著立體匹配技術的發展,雙攝智能手機得到了普及應用,而手機用戶對拍照,或預覽背景虛化效果的需求也越來越強烈,那么如何能夠通過優化立體匹配算法獲取到質量極佳的視差圖,成為了目前雙攝智能手機應用中亟待解決的技術問題。
目前,立體匹配算法主要分為局部立體匹配(Local Stereo Matching,LSM),半全局立體匹配(Semi-Global Matching,SGM)和全局立體匹配(Global Stereo Matching,GSM)三類。LSM算法復雜度最低,但是輸出視差圖質量較差,GSM算法的視差圖質量最好,但是復雜度也最高,SGM算法雖然在性能上相對于GSM算法有所改善,但是算法質量卻有所降低。
所以,上述通過立體匹配算法獲取視差圖的方法,存在不能同時提高視差圖的質量和降低立體匹配算法的復雜度的問題。
發明內容
基于此,有必要針對上述技術問題,提供一種能夠有效同時提高視差圖的質量和降低立體匹配算法的復雜度的視差圖的獲取方法、裝置、計算機設備和存儲介質。
第一方面,一種視差圖的獲取方法,所述方法包括:
采用融合匹配代價函數計算輸入圖像中各像素點的匹配代價值,得到輸入圖像的第一匹配代價;融合匹配代價函數為至少兩種類型的匹配代價函數融合得到的函數;
對第一匹配代價進行匹配代價聚合,得到輸入圖像的第二匹配代價;
采用SGM算法或GSM算法,對輸入圖像中的邊緣像素點在第二匹配代價中對應的匹配代價值進行優化,得到輸入圖像的第三匹配代價;
根據第三匹配代價確定出輸入圖像中所有像素點的目標匹配代價值,并根據目標匹配代價值對應的視差值得到輸入圖像的視差圖。
在其中一個實施例中,融合匹配代價函數為梯度的灰度相關AD匹配代價函數和左右采樣BT匹配代價函數融合得到的函數。
在其中一個實施例中,采用SGM算法或GSM算法,對第二匹配代價中的邊緣匹配代價值進行優化,得到輸入圖像的第三匹配代價,包括:
采用預設的定位算子,確定出輸入圖像中的邊緣像素點的坐標;
根據邊緣像素點的坐標,得到第二匹配代價中的邊緣匹配代價值;
采用SGM算法或GSM算法,對邊緣匹配代價值進行優化處理,得到輸入圖像的第三匹配代價。
在其中一個實施例中,采用預設的定位算子,確定出輸入圖像中的邊緣像素點的坐標,包括:
將Canny算子、水平方向的梯度算子和垂直方向的梯度算子進行加權求和,得到定位算子;
采用定位算子,確定出輸入圖像中的邊緣像素點的坐標。
在其中一個實施例中,對第一匹配代價進行匹配代價聚合,得到輸入圖像的第二匹配代價,包括:
根據輸入圖像的每個像素點的坐標、以及預設半徑,確定每個像素點對應的固定窗口;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京邁格威科技有限公司,未經北京邁格威科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201910911950.2/2.html,轉載請聲明來源鉆瓜專利網。





